The most racially diverse public elementary schools in Fairfax County, Virginia

This ranking covers the most racially diverse public elementary schools in Fairfax County, Virginia, drawn from 143 qualifying public elementary schools. Halley Elementary leads the list at 25.8%, against a median of 48.5% across the ranked schools.
